While there isn't a single "viral" blog post under that exact title, several recent technical updates and troubleshooting guides from Thermo Fisher Scientific address significant "fixes" for the Niton Connect software suite. These updates primarily focus on enhancing the stability of data transfers from handheld XRF analyzers to PCs. Key Software Fixes and Improvements
- Method Setup: The software allows administrators to lock in (fix) specific testing parameters. For example, in PMI (Positive Material Identification), you can configure the dwell time, filters, and calibration checks. Once these are "fixed" in the software and pushed to the device, the operator cannot alter them, ensuring strict Quality Assurance (QA).
- Fixed Element Lists: Users can define exactly which elements appear on the analyzer's screen. If your facility only cares about Cr, Ni, and Mo, you can fix this display view via the software, reducing operator confusion.
- Empirical Calibration: The software allows for the creation of "Fixed" calibration curves based on site-specific standards. This is vital when analyzing strange alloys or non-standard matrices where factory calibrations might drift.
